Sorry to hear about your health. That's is a nice set-up, not running due to battery is a no brainer, but not running due to mechanical issues is a different ball game all together.

*Running, with those mods and that mileage you are close to that $10k

*If all it needs is a battery, then you are looking at drastically less than $10k, maybe around $7,500.00 to $8,500.00 (have a friend or neighbor change the battery for you)

*Non-Running due to Mechanical Issues this is where you'll get hit in the head, you'll might get $5k to $6k
